Embodiment 1
[0013] Embodiment one: if figure 1 As shown, the elastic displacement compensator of the present invention includes a sleeve 2 with a cylindrical cavity 1, the sleeve 2 is made of an elastic flexible material, and several rigid joints coaxial with the sleeve 2 are arranged in the sleeve 2. Reinforcing ring 3. The inner wall of the casing 2 is provided with at least one inner sealing ring 5 . The outer ring of the casing 2 is provided with at least one anti-seepage groove 6 and / or a convex anti-seepage sealing ring 7 . In this embodiment, three inner sealing rings 5 are arranged, one of which is arranged on the outermost side of the casing 2 and the inspection shaft; two anti-seepage grooves 6 are arranged. The truncated surface of the inner sealing ring 5 is an isosceles acute triangle.

Embodiment 2
[0015] Embodiment two: if figure 2 As shown, the difference from the first embodiment is that a helical rigid rib 4 coaxial with the sleeve 2 is provided inside the sleeve 2 .
